What is the meaning of "225 units"?
|
|
|
02-09-2010, 11:19 AM
|
#19
|
Join Date: Dec 2005
Location: Albany, Or.
Posts: 1,094
|
Re: Traeger Digital Thermostats
The 225 units are called that because their settings go from smoke straight to 225 and then up from there in 25 degree increments. They also used to make a 180 that started at smoke, went to 180 and then to 250 and up from there. They have now started to remake the 180's but are a bit different from the originals.
